What exactly does a Gainesville pet spa offer? Think of it as a full-service day of relaxation and care tailored specifically for your pet. Beyond the essential bath and blow-dry, many of our local spas provide services like blueberry facials to brighten white fur, soothing oatmeal baths for sensitive skin (perfect for our pollen-heavy seasons), and expert de-shedding treatments to keep your home and your pet more comfortable. The real magic often lies in the skilled grooming—precise haircuts, nail trims, and ear cleaning performed by professionals who understand breed standards and your pet's unique needs.

Before you book an appointment, here's some practical advice. First, do a little research. Ask fellow pet owners at the Gainesville Square Farmers Market or your vet for recommendations. Visit the facility if possible to ensure it's clean and calm. Always communicate clearly about your pet's temperament, any health issues, and exactly what you want from the groom. A good spa will welcome your questions and provide a consultation.
